  • Xcèntric - Maria Klonaris / Katerina Thomadaki: retratos fílmicos

    By on

    Paralelamente a la realización de sus singulares autorretratos cinematográficos, Maria Klonaris y Katerina Thomadaki emprendieron a principios de la década de los ochenta la «Série Portraits», en la cual reinventan el arte del retrato fílmico componiendo imágenes de mujeres que no responden a ninguna idea preconcebida de la «feminidad» y abordando una reflexión ética del sujeto-mujer en un diálogo que pone a prueba las fronteras entre el Yo y el Otro.

  • Sonic Cinema: Austrian synaesthetic cinema feat. TWIXT live A/V + Q&A

    By on

    Sonic Cinema is thrilled to present an evening of recent films by Austrian audiovisual artists exploring the boundaries of perception. Through the concepts of visual music and synaesthesia –a neurological condition that causes a blending of the senses– these formally adventurous works blur the boundaries between the visual and sonic arts.

  • DIM Cinema: Make Me Up

    By on

    In her most ambitious work to date, the incomparable Scottish multimedia artist Rachel Maclean “takes a cyber cleaver to art history," a weapon made no less dangerous by its pink and purple glitter-coated handle. Siri, the protagonist, “finds herself at the centre of what appears to be an impossible game show, helmed by the Figurehead, an ornately dressed Maclean lip-syncing to Kenneth Clark’s [classic 1960s BBC TV series] Civilisation.
